How Do You Apply a Blue Black Hair Rinse at Home for Best Results?
To apply a blue-black hair rinse at home for the best results, follow these steps: prepare your hair, mix the rinse, apply it evenly, leave it on as directed, and rinse thoroughly.
-
Prepare your hair:
– Clean hair: Wash your hair with a gentle shampoo. Avoid using conditioner, as this can create a barrier for the rinse.
– Towel dry: Gently towel dry your hair until it’s damp but not dripping wet. This helps the rinse absorb better. -
Mix the rinse:
– Follow instructions: Read the manufacturer’s guidance for the correct mixing ratio, often found on the product label.
– Combine: Typically, mix the blue-black dye with a developer in a non-metallic bowl. Wear gloves to protect your hands. -
Apply it evenly:
– Section your hair: Divide your hair into manageable sections to ensure even application. Use clips to hold sections in place.
– Use the applicator: Apply the rinse from roots to ends using a brush applicator or your hands. Ensure all strands are coated for uniform color. -
Leave it on as directed:
– Timing: Check the product instructions for the recommended processing time. This may range from 15 to 30 minutes.
– Monitor: Keep an eye on the color development. Perform a strand test if possible, to confirm the desired shade. -
Rinse thoroughly:
– Thoroughly rinse: Use lukewarm water to rinse out the rinse until the water runs clear. This removes any excess product.
– Condition: Follow up with a conditioner to condition your hair, as hair dyes can cause dryness. Use a sulfate-free conditioner for best results.
Keep in mind that proper application and timing are crucial for achieving a vibrant blue-black color. Consider conducting a patch test to assess any allergic reactions, as recommended by the American Academy of Dermatology.
How Long Can You Expect a Semi-Permanent Blue Black Hair Rinse to Last?
A semi-permanent blue-black hair rinse typically lasts between four to six weeks. This duration can vary based on several factors, including hair type, maintenance routines, and washing frequency.
For individuals with healthier hair, the color may last longer, closer to six weeks. In contrast, those with damaged or porous hair may see the color fade more quickly, potentially within four weeks. Studies show that hair with cuticles (the outer layer) that are tightly closed retains color better than damaged hair, where the cuticles are raised.
Example scenarios include a person who washes their hair daily. This individual may experience faster fading due to frequent exposure to water and shampoo, both of which can strip color. Conversely, someone who washes their hair once a week may enjoy the color for a longer period.
Additional factors influencing how long the color lasts include the products used for washing and styling, exposure to sunlight, and chlorine in swimming pools. Sulfate-free shampoos can help prolong the color, while sun exposure can cause fading due to UV damage.
It’s important to note that individual experiences may vary widely, and these time frames are averages. Hair health and maintenance routines substantially impact the longevity of the color, making it essential to consider personal habits when estimating duration.
What Tips Will Help Enhance the Effectiveness of Your Blue Black Hair Rinse?
To enhance the effectiveness of your blue black hair rinse, consider implementing the following tips. These practices will help improve the shine, longevity, and overall appearance of your blue black hair.
- Use a pH-balanced shampoo before rinsing.
- Apply the hair rinse on clean, damp hair.
- Allow for sufficient processing time.
- Avoid washing hair immediately after the rinse.
- Use a conditioner formulated for dark or colored hair.
- Reapply every few weeks for best results.
- Store the rinse properly to maintain its effectiveness.
The following points elaborate on each tip for enhancing your blue black hair rinse.
-
Using a pH-balanced shampoo before rinsing: Using a pH-balanced shampoo before rinsing helps to prepare your hair for color treatment. A shampoo with a balanced pH minimizes cuticle damage and opens the hair shafts, allowing the rinse to penetrate better. Hair typically has a pH of 4.5 to 5.5. Using an appropriate shampoo ensures that the rinse adheres evenly for richer color.
-
Applying the hair rinse on clean, damp hair: Applying the hair rinse on clean, damp hair enhances its absorption. When hair is free from grease and products, the color has less obstruction. This ensures that the blue black pigments can deeply penetrate the hair shaft, providing a more vibrant and saturated color.
-
Allowing for sufficient processing time: Allowing for sufficient processing time is crucial for achieving the desired intensity of color. Generally, leaving the rinse on for at least 20-30 minutes allows the pigments to adhere effectively. This time frame can vary depending on the product, so always refer to the instructions for optimal results.
-
Avoiding washing hair immediately after the rinse: Avoiding washing hair immediately after the rinse allows the color to settle and prevent premature fading. Waiting at least 24-48 hours before washing helps secure the hair dye within the strands. This practice prolongs the vibrancy of the blue black hue.
-
Using a conditioner formulated for dark or colored hair: Using a conditioner formulated for dark or colored hair helps maintain color while adding moisture. These conditioners are specifically designed to be gentle and preserve the vibrancy of dyed hair. Look for products with nourishing ingredients that protect against fading.
-
Reapplying every few weeks for best results: Reapplying every few weeks for best results ensures that your blue black color remains fresh and vibrant. Hair color naturally fades over time, especially with washing and environmental exposure. Regular application of the rinse can help replenish lost color and maintain depth.
-
Storing the rinse properly to maintain its effectiveness: Storing the rinse properly to maintain its effectiveness is essential for longevity. Keep the rinse in a cool, dark place to prevent degradation of the color compounds. Exposure to light and heat can cause color molecules to break down, reducing effectiveness over time.
